Notre Dame High School, Norwich

In 1889 a new wing was built to accommodate around 70 boarding pupils, and in 1915 what is now Franchise House with adjoining land on Surrey Street, was purchased.

In 2006, the St Paul's building was extensively refurbished, providing a Drama Studio and four new classrooms for Religious Education.

The new St Mary's building was completed by the end of October 2006, and houses a Sixth Form centre, a cafeteria, a library and extensive language classrooms.

Mr John Pinnington became the first lay headmaster of the school in January 1997, as successor of Sister Mary Cluderay.

Following a long internal and public consultation, it was decided that the school would acquire Academy status on 1 March 2012.
